  • This is a hiking tour, not a summit tour. The tour ascends to the 7th Station (~2,900m) and returns on the same day.

  • Participants must be physically prepared to hike for approximately 5–6 hours with 900m of elevation gain.

  • All movement during the tour is on foot along mountain trails, which include steep, rocky, and sandy sections, so proper footwear and appropriate clothing are essential for your safety and comfort.

  • Participants must bring their own light lunch and sufficient snacks. Eating is only possible during breaks on the mountain.

  • Even at mid-level elevations, some hikers may feel dizzy, tired, or nauseated. Please hydrate, take breaks, and inform your guide if unwell.

  • This tour is not suitable for those with mobility issues, recent injuries, or serious health conditions.

  • Rain, fog, or cold winds are common even in summer. You must bring proper gear for cold and wet conditions.

  • Toilets are limited and may require ¥100 coins. Please prepare small change and expect basic facilities.

  • Littering is strictly prohibited. Please carry back all trash to preserve the environment.
